About this course

This degree prepares you for a career as a specialist health and physical education teacher, providing you with a qualification to teach in secondary schools.

Throughout this course, you will:

  • complete over 100 days of teaching practice
  • study three teaching methods, for health, physical education, and one elective subject area
  • gain sports coaching experience
  • have the option to undertake an accelerated course, completing your degree in 3.5 years.

The Bachelor of Health, Physical Education and Sport focuses on teaching practice, and aims to prepare you to work in the dynamic and challenging world of education.

Career pathways

Strong employment opportunities exist in government, independent, private and specialist schools.

Additional employment opportunities exist in:

  • educational leadership
  • sports and sports coaching
  • health, wellness and fitness promotion.

Over the past five years, more than 95% of graduates seeking teacher employment have been successful within six months of graduating. Graduates go on to teach in three subject areas, including health, physical education, and the subject area of your choosing. This degree also boasts high employability rates and student satisfaction.
